Transaction 70b51d60ecb4a34738603efb8af17b7b74ba61c6b4057b8b72b90a6480ea1f5a

1 Input
2 Outputs
  • 70b51d60ecb4a34738603efb8af17b7b74ba61c6b4057b8b72b90a6480ea1f5a:0
  • value  4080633
    address  1EaQwvZe4nSdf49sjn22DAdhNqh2MEVWCG
  • 70b51d60ecb4a34738603efb8af17b7b74ba61c6b4057b8b72b90a6480ea1f5a:1
  • value  102521474
    address  35DqiNiov9xm96e6eF2TbHUbMJXhL5GFKt